Sunset Strip palace of sushi, sports, singing and singles.
by Contributor at Citysearch
In Short
With three floors of action, Miyagi's caters to every taste. Level one offers casual dining and big-screen TVs for the sushi-loving sports fan. Walk up to level two for a more intimate dining lounge with cozy booths and a fireplace. The overall look: Japanese garden meets contemporary dance club. Diners feast on sushi next to waterfalls and TVs playing videos, but after midnight the tables are gone and the Top 40-fueled dancing begins.
